Reception of passengers transferring from international to domestic flights at Belgrade airport

8 April 2022

As of April 8, the procedure of transferring international arrivals to Air Serbia domestic flights to Niš was changed at Nikola Tesla Belgrade Airport. Passengers transferring from international flights to a domestic flight, now pass passport control and exit the airport building to return to the domestic (departure) waiting room A11 (on the ground floor of Terminal 1).

In order to be adequately informed, and to reduce the time required for the transfer of passengers arriving on international flights to a domestic flight, maps have been posted around the building and on the airport website directing passenger movement, brochures with appropriate information have been prepared, passenger flow directions are marked in the form of signposts and information signs guiding passengers along the shortest route to waiting room A11, and there is an information point in front of the arrivals passport control from which staff will direct passengers to the A11 waiting room.

If necessary, the staff at the information point will welcome passengers continuing their trip by domestic flight who need to be directed to waiting room A11, pointing them to the priority line for inspection and control of documents at the passport control desk, where the document control process will be performed faster and from where passengers will be directed on to the baggage claim hall.
